Senior Manager, Social Media
OneMagnify, Detroit, Michigan, United States, 48228
OneMagnify is a global performance marketing organization working at the intersection of brand marketing, technology, and analytics. The Company’s core offerings accelerate business, amplify real-time results, and help set their clients apart from their competitors. OneMagnify partners with clients to design, implement, and manage marketing and brand strategies using analytical and predictive data models that provide valuable customer insights to drive higher levels of sales conversion.
We are seeking an experienced Senior Manager, Social Media to lead our social media team and drive innovative social marketing strategies for our diverse portfolio of B2B and B2C clients. If you're a proven leader with a passion for social media and a track record of success, we’d love to connect!
About you:
Validated experience leading social media teams and running large client portfolios
Strong knowledge of digital and traditional marketing, with a knack for integrating these strategies
Effective leadership and collaboration skills to inspire and develop a diverse team
Expertise in digital analytics and social media optimization tactics
Excellent communication, project management, and presentation skills
What you’ll do:
Lead and mentor a team of social media managers and coordinators by guiding social media strategy and developing the team's overall skills
Develop social media strategies and launch new channels, ensuring brand consistency and attention to detail at all times
Handle onboarding of all new social media clients
Develop and maintain social media campaigns using a strong understanding of client business goals and marketing objectives
Build proposal decks and pitches for prospective clients
Serve as a trusted advisor on all social media questions, concerns, and opportunities
Analyze monthly organic and paid social data to provide optimization recommendations and lead reporting reviews, incorporating insights from management tools, digital platforms, and web analytics
Collaborate with Facebook, LinkedIn, and other platform contacts to help optimize campaigns
What you’ll need:
BA or BS or equivalent experience from an accredited college or university
8+ years of social management experience, and extensive digital marketing knowledge
3+ years of personnel management experience
Commanding knowledge and proficiency with all social tools, including but not limited to planning tools (Sprinklr / Hootsuite / Sprout / Meltwater / Falcon), listening tools (Meltwater / Talkwalker / Netbase / Khoros), and tracking tools (LinkTree / Later / Bitly)
Extensive experience developing, optimizing, analyzing, and reporting on paid and organic campaigns on social platforms
Self-starter able to prioritize and consistently handle multiple tasks across various clients and teams.
A positive outlook, flexibility, and ability to learn
